'68 Olympics Salute Shouldn't Be Glorified

By Sam Biddle,  Newser Staff

Posted Jul 29, 2008 11:43 AM CDT

(Newser) – Last week ESPN honored athletes Tommie Smith and John Carlos, famous for their  ‘black power’ salute at the ’68 Olympic games, with the Arthur Ashe Courage Award at the network’s ESPYs award ceremony. LA Times commentator Jonah Goldberg outlines what he considers...   Read full story »
